Skip to content

164 News

  • About Us
  • Contact Us
  • Privacy Policy
  • Terms of Service
  • Cookie Policy/GDPR
  • Toggle search form
raft-640x480-24065761.jpeg

Understanding Raft: Structure and Use Cases in Modern Data Management

Posted on January 17, 2025 By Raft

Raft is a powerful distributed consensus algorithm designed for reliable data management in challenging network environments. It achieves fault tolerance by dividing nodes into roles (Leader, Follower, Candidate), ensuring efficient synchronization and leadership succession. This system guarantees data consistency even during disruptions like network partitions or node failures, replicates data across multiple nodes for identical copies, and maintains data integrity and system reliability through leaders proposing and applying changes while followers replicate under their guidance.

A Raft is a distributed consensus algorithm designed for fault-tolerant systems. It enables clusters of nodes to achieve agreement on a shared log, ensuring data integrity and system reliability. Originating from the need for robust and scalable coordination in dynamic networks, Raft has evolved as a foundational technology in modern data management and cloud computing. By facilitating leader election and log replication, Raft ensures consistency across distributed environments, making it indispensable for maintaining order and coherence in complex systems.

  • What is a Raft?
  • – Definition and basic concept

What is a Raft?

Raft

A Raft is a distributed consensus algorithm designed to enable a cluster of nodes to reach agreement on a shared log of events. It was initially developed to address the challenges of fault tolerance and consistency in distributed systems, particularly in environments where network partitions and node failures are common. The Raft algorithm guarantees that even in the face of such disruptions, the system can maintain a consistent view of its data across all nodes.

This algorithm operates by having each node maintain a local log of events and periodically synchronize with neighboring nodes to ensure consensus. It consists of three primary roles: Leader, Follower, and Candidate. The Leader is responsible for managing the shared log and coordinating updates, while Followers replicate the log and respond to requests from clients or other nodes. Candidates, on the other hand, step up when a Leader fails or becomes unavailable, contending for the leadership role through a vote-based process that ensures fairness and stability.

– Definition and basic concept

Raft

A Raft is a distributed consensus algorithm designed to enable a group of nodes in a network to reach agreement on a single, shared value. At its core, the concept revolves around replicating data across multiple nodes and ensuring that all nodes maintain an identical copy, even in the face of network failures or node crashes. This redundancy acts as a safety net, guaranteeing data integrity and system reliability. Each node in a Raft cluster plays a specific role: some act as leaders responsible for proposing and applying changes, while others serve as followers, replicating and synchronizing data under the direction of the leader.

A Raft is an innovative technology designed to enhance data replication and distributed systems. By providing a reliable and efficient way to manage data across multiple nodes, Raft ensures high availability and fault tolerance. It is primarily used by developers and engineers in the tech industry who require robust solutions for building scalable and resilient applications. Whether it’s for cloud computing, blockchain development, or big data processing, Raft offers a structured approach to maintaining consistent data, making it an indispensable tool in today’s digital landscape.

Raft

Post navigation

Previous Post: Understanding Raft: Enabling Collaboration in Distributed Systems
Next Post: What is a Raft? Understanding Its Purpose and Users

Recent Posts

  • Eiskalte Verfolgungen! ❄️ – COPS vs RACER Most Wanted – FORZA HORIZON 4 – FHMPSS
  • Mastering FMEA for Effective Risk Prioritization in Six Sigma Projects
  • Trend Charts: Tracking Six Sigma’s Risk Improvements Visualized
  • Six Sigma Risk Management: Unlocking Attributes with P Charts
  • Optimize Your Private Blog Network: Curate, Create, Share Knowledge

Recent Comments

  1. @DirkRene-wf6zv on Eiskalte Verfolgungen! ❄️ – COPS vs RACER Most Wanted – FORZA HORIZON 4 – FHMPSS
  2. @adrianenders3506 on Eiskalte Verfolgungen! ❄️ – COPS vs RACER Most Wanted – FORZA HORIZON 4 – FHMPSS
  3. @ZoqqerFabian on Eiskalte Verfolgungen! ❄️ – COPS vs RACER Most Wanted – FORZA HORIZON 4 – FHMPSS
  4. @HueMaximus on Eiskalte Verfolgungen! ❄️ – COPS vs RACER Most Wanted – FORZA HORIZON 4 – FHMPSS
  5. @Raphael.B218 on Eiskalte Verfolgungen! ❄️ – COPS vs RACER Most Wanted – FORZA HORIZON 4 – FHMPSS

Archives

  • May 2025
  • April 2025
  • March 2025
  • February 2025
  • January 2025
  • December 2024
  • November 2024
  • October 2024
  • May 2024

Categories

  • Aerospace
  • Amazon
  • Beverage
  • Boost search engine rankings with a private blog network
  • Build authority in multiple niches with a private blog network
  • Build authority with a PBN
  • Build influencer relationships with a private blog network
  • Create client segment network with a PBN
  • Create guest posting platform with a private blog network
  • Create portfolio of websites with a PBN
  • Develop industry presence with a PBN
  • Develop reputation management strategy with a private blog network
  • Develop system for sharing knowledge with a private blog network
  • Diversify online income streams with a PBN
  • Diversify online income through affiliate marketing with a PBN
  • Drive traffic to events with a private blog network
  • Drive traffic to membership sites with a PBN
  • Ebay
  • Elderly Companion Services
  • Energy Storage Solutions
  • Establish niche credibility with private blog network
  • Event Planning for Local Businesses
  • FMEA and Risk Prioritization in Six Sigma
  • Generate leads with targeted posts on a PBN
  • Home Repair and Maintenance
  • House Sitting
  • Houseboat
  • Houseboat campaign 2
  • Lawn Care and Landscaping
  • Local Food Delivery and Meal Preparation
  • Local Tutoring and Education Services
  • MotorBoat
  • Promote digital products with a PBN
  • Promote products on multiple sites with a PBN
  • Promote services to specific regions with a private blog network
  • Pulses
  • Racing Games
  • Raft
  • Rear Wheel Drive
  • Renewable Energy Innovations
  • Risk Assessment and Analysis in Six Sigma
  • sailboat
  • samsung
  • Share user-generated content through a PBN
  • Six Sigma Risk Management Strategies
  • Skincare
  • Steam Boat
  • Submarine
  • Test SEO strategies with a private blog network
  • test378
  • test398
  • Yard Waste Removal and Recycling

Copyright © 2025 164 News.

Powered by PressBook Dark WordPress theme